.tooltipster-base{--tooltip-color:#fff;--tooltip-bg-color:#000}.off-canvas-right .mfp-content,.off-canvas-left .mfp-content{--drawer-width:300px}.off-canvas .mfp-content.off-canvas-cart{--drawer-width:450px}.row.row-small{max-width:1562.5px}.transparent .header-main{height:90px}.transparent #logo img{max-height:90px}.has-transparent+.page-title:first-of-type,.has-transparent+#main>.page-title,.has-transparent+#main>div>.page-title,.has-transparent+#main .page-header-wrapper:first-of-type .page-title{padding-top:170px}.header.show-on-scroll,.stuck .header-main{height:70px!important}.stuck #logo img{max-height:70px!important}.stuck .header-main .nav>li>a{line-height:50px}.mobile-sidebar-levels-2 .nav>li>ul>li>a{font-family:"Titillium Web",sans-serif}.widget .tagcloud a:hover{border-color:#000;background-color:#000}.shop-page-title.featured-title .title-overlay{background-color:rgba(0,0,0,.3)}.pswp__bg,.mfp-bg.mfp-ready{background-color:#161616}@media screen and (min-width:550px){.products .box-vertical .box-image{min-width:400px!important;width:400px!important}}.header-main .header-button>.button.is-outline,.header-main .cart-icon strong:after,.header-main .cart-icon strong{border-color:#000!important}.header-main .header-button>.button:not(.is-outline){background-color:#000!important}.header-main .current-dropdown .cart-icon strong,.header-main .header-button>.button:hover,.header-main .header-button>.button:hover i,.header-main .header-button>.button:hover span{color:#fff!important}.header-main .current-dropdown .cart-icon strong,.header-main .header-button>.button:hover{background-color:#000!important}.header-main .current-dropdown .cart-icon strong:after,.header-main .current-dropdown .cart-icon strong,.header-main .header-button>.button:hover{border-color:#000!important}.nav-vertical-fly-out>li+li{border-top-width:1px;border-top-style:solid}.nav-box>li.active>a,.nav-pills>li.active>a{background-color:var(--fs-color-primary);color:#000;opacity:1}.accordion-title{border-top:0px solid #ddd;display:block;font-size:16px;padding:.6em 1.7em;position:relative;text-align-last:left}.accordion .toggle{border-radius:999px;height:1.5em;left:0;margin-right:5px;position:absolute;top:.3em;transform-origin:50% 47%;width:1.3em}.accordion-title.active{background-color:#fff;border-color:var(--fs-color-primary);color:#000;font-weight:400}.label-new.menu-item>a:after{content:"Nuevo"}.label-hot.menu-item>a:after{content:"Caliente"}.label-sale.menu-item>a:after{content:"Oferta"}.label-popular.menu-item>a:after{content:"Populares"}